Bwindi Lodge – Bwindi Impenetrable Forest

Tucked away in the misty hills of southwestern Uganda, Bwindi Lodge is often considered one of the most enchanting places to stay while visiting the famed mountain gorillas. The lodge is perched on the edge of Bwindi Impenetrable Forest, giving guests panoramic views of the dense jungle that is home to half of the world’s remaining gorillas.

Each stone-and-timber banda at Bwindi Lodge is stylishly designed, combining rustic charm with modern luxury. Fireplaces keep the interiors cozy, while private verandas offer views of the forest canopy where colobus monkeys leap and birds call throughout the day. The award-winning lodge also has a forest spa, where guests can unwind after a gorilla trek with soothing massages that blend local techniques with natural products.

What makes Bwindi Lodge truly special is the sense of intimacy with the forest. The atmosphere feels otherworldly, as if you’re a guest of the jungle itself. For travelers who wish to pair gorilla trekking with refined comfort, this lodge is unmatched.

Mihingo Lodge – Lake Mburo National Park

Mihingo Lodge offers a unique luxury experience in the heart of Lake Mburo National Park, one of Uganda’s most picturesque reserves. Built on a rocky kopje, the lodge features elevated tented rooms that blend seamlessly into the surrounding acacia woodland. Each tent offers sweeping views of the savannah, making the sunset here a daily spectacle.

Mihingo is known for its infinity pool, which seems to spill into the wilderness below. Watching zebra, impala, and even giraffes from the poolside is a surreal experience. Guests can also enjoy night game drives, walking safaris, and horse riding—one of the few places in Uganda where this is possible.

The lodge’s eco-friendly design and commitment to conservation add to its appeal. Mihingo is more than just luxury—it is sustainable luxury that allows travelers to enjoy comfort without compromising nature.

Clouds Mountain Gorilla Lodge – Nkuringo, Bwindi

Set high in the Nkuringo sector of Bwindi Impenetrable National Park, Clouds Mountain Gorilla Lodge lives up to its name. At nearly 2,000 meters above sea level, the lodge feels like it is perched among the clouds, with sweeping views over the Virunga Volcanoes and the vast forest below.

The lodge features spacious stone cottages, each with its own fireplace, plush furnishings, and private butler service. The interiors are decorated with local art, and the terraces provide perfect spots for gazing across the dramatic landscapes. Guests here not only enjoy luxury but also the rare tranquility that comes with such altitude and isolation.

Clouds is also deeply connected to the local community, with many of its staff members and projects directly benefiting nearby villages. Staying here means supporting conservation and livelihoods while indulging in one of Uganda’s finest hospitality experiences.

Apoka Safari Lodge – Kidepo Valley National Park

For travelers seeking luxury in one of Africa’s most remote and untouched landscapes, Apoka Safari Lodge in Kidepo Valley National Park is a dream come true. Kidepo is often called Uganda’s hidden gem, a place where vast plains stretch endlessly and wildlife sightings feel private and exclusive.

Apoka Safari Lodge sits in the heart of this wilderness, with spacious stone cottages that feature outdoor bathtubs, oversized beds, and hand-woven carpets. The design is simple yet elegant, allowing nature to remain the star of the show. From your veranda, it is not uncommon to see elephants, buffalo, or giraffes wandering nearby.

The lodge also boasts a natural rock swimming pool, carved into the kopje itself, offering breathtaking views of the savannah. Apoka is luxury redefined—it is raw, remote, and utterly unforgettable.

Kyambura Gorge Lodge – Queen Elizabeth National Park

Queen Elizabeth National Park is one of Uganda’s most diverse and iconic safari destinations, and Kyambura Gorge Lodge is its jewel. Once an old coffee-processing plant, the lodge has been transformed into a stylish retreat that overlooks the mystical Kyambura Gorge and the savannah plains beyond.

Each banda is individually designed, featuring contemporary comforts blended with African chic. The views stretch over rolling hills to the snow-capped Rwenzori Mountains in the distance. The lodge’s infinity pool is a highlight, offering a cooling escape after game drives or chimpanzee trekking in the gorge.

Kyambura Gorge Lodge also invests heavily in conservation and community projects, making it a place where luxury meets responsibility. Guests leave not only with memories of elephants, tree-climbing lions, and flamingos but also with the satisfaction of supporting meaningful initiatives.

Nile Safari Lodge – Murchison Falls National Park

Few places in Uganda combine river views and refined luxury quite like Nile Safari Lodge. Nestled along the banks of the River Nile in Murchison Falls National Park, the lodge is designed to give guests uninterrupted views of the water, where hippos wallow and fish eagles soar.

The lodge offers spacious thatched cottages and private suites, each with open verandas for sunrise or sunset gazing. Guests can take a dip in the infinity pool overlooking the Nile, or relax in the open-air lounge with a glass of wine as the river flows endlessly past.

Boat cruises to the base of Murchison Falls and game drives on the park’s expansive savannah make this location ideal for combining adventure with indulgence. Nile Safari Lodge is where the power of the river meets the comfort of luxury.

Baker’s Lodge – Murchison Falls National Park

Another gem on the banks of the Nile, Baker’s Lodge offers an intimate luxury experience named after the legendary British explorer Samuel Baker. With just a handful of cottages spread along the riverbank, the lodge prioritizes exclusivity and personal attention.

Raised wooden decks allow for close-up views of wildlife, while the interiors are elegantly appointed with spacious beds, en-suite bathrooms, and private verandas. The lodge is particularly magical at night, with lanterns lighting the pathways and the sounds of the river providing a natural lullaby.

Baker’s Lodge is perfect for those who want to experience Murchison Falls with sophistication, blending old-world charm with modern comforts.

Sanctuary Gorilla Forest Camp – Bwindi

Nestled deep inside Bwindi Impenetrable National Park, Sanctuary Gorilla Forest Camp is one of the most exclusive places to stay for gorilla trekking. Its location within the park makes it not only convenient but also unique, as gorillas are known to occasionally wander into the camp.

The lodge features just a handful of luxury tents, ensuring privacy and intimacy. Each tent is equipped with comfortable beds, en-suite bathrooms, and wooden decks overlooking the forest. The campfire evenings, combined with gourmet dining and personalized service, create an atmosphere of adventure wrapped in luxury.

For travelers wanting an authentic yet indulgent gorilla trekking base, Sanctuary Gorilla Forest Camp is unmatched.
